Includes bibliographical references (p. 339-359) and indexes.
The authors discuss biblical theology of mission, provide historical overviews of the development of various viewpoints, and address theologically current issues in global mission from an evangelical perspective. --from publisher description
Biblical foundations of mission. God and the nations in the Old Testament ; God and the nations in the New Testament ; The justification of mission : missio Dei ; The purpose and nature of mission ; The task of missions : convictions and controversy ; The task of missions : convergence and conclusions -- Motives and means for mission. The motivation for missions ; The church and mission ; The missionary vocation ; Spiritual dynamics and mission -- Mission in local and global context. Contextualization and mission ; Christian encounter with other religions : toward an evangelical theology of religions ; The necessity of mission : three uncomfortable questions.
